The purchase of marine-based ‘internet of things’ business Siren Marine by Yamaha would allow the industry giant to offer a fully connected experience with its watercraft.
Yamaha Motor Corporation USA’s marine subsidiary intended to purchase Siren Marine by the end of 2021, following a minority investment in it last March.
